12/26/2006: United Kingdom Government Aims to Change New Pension Regime to Avoid Abuse (Watson Wyatt Worldwide)
Excerpt: "The government is proposing further changes to the new tax regime for pensions that came into force on April 6, 2006, in an effort to prevent abuses and relax or simplify provisions that are proving difficult for pension schemes to administer. U.K. Chancellor of the Exchequer, Gordon Brown, announced the proposals in his pre-budget report on December 6, 2006."
